Medical Park, Gastonia, NC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Medical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Medical Park Studio Apartments | $970 | $850 | $1,175 |
| Medical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,331 | $959 | $1,600 |
| Medical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,624 | $1,117 | $2,045 |
| Medical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,077 | $1,195 | $2,450 |
| Medical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,311 | $1,495 | $2,720 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Medical Park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Medical Park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Medical Park is $1,596.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Medical Park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Medical Park is a 1,460 square feet unit starting from $1,175 at Center City Crossing.
What is the average size for Medical Park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Medical Park is currently at 734 sq ft.
